At the age of thirteen, Kenneth Adams, a formerly popular football player, was diagnosed with Metastatic Osteosarcoma, or bone cancer, which had spread. After an intense battle, he is finally hoping to end the full war against a body that turned against him. He is attempting to cope with his new-found perspective.  One with his family, friends, and himself. 

"We are not invincible. We would all love to think we are, but we aren't. So, we make up people that are. Someone helpful, powerful, and strong. Someone who can't be killed. Like Superman. That is, until 1943, in "The Meteor from Krypton," when a green space-rock was introduced as his weakness. One that drains his superhuman abilities. 
     My weakness is a lot less badass."
